AbstractPrevious studies using anti‐CD45R monoclonal antibodies (mAb) have shown that normal CD4+T cells can be separated into virgin and memory cells basedon their level of expression of CD45R. CD45Rhi(virgin)T cells secrete interleukin (IL)‐2 whereas CD45Rlo(memory) T cells secrete both IL‐2 and IL‐4. In contrast to these results, studies using cultured T cell lines haveshown that IL‐2‐secreting T helper cell type 1 (Th1) cells are CD45Rloand IL‐4‐secreting Th2 cells are CD45Rhi. To resolve this discrepancy, and to determine how the Th1 and Th2 cell lines relate to memory CD45Rloand virgin CD45RhiCD4+T cells, we have isolated CD45Rlocells from alloantigen‐primed mice and developed allospecific Th1 and Th2 cell lines. The lymphokinessecreted by these lines were then evaluated. Our results show that as CD45RloT cells develop intoin vitrocell lines which secrete IL‐4, they become CD45Rhi. In contrast, CD45Rlocells that develop into lines which secrete IL‐2 maintain their CD45Rlophenotype. Thus, although both Th1 and Th2 cells arise initially from CD45Rlocells, Th2 cells become CD45Rhiduring prolongedin vitroculture
